Blender Git Loki

Git Commits -> Revision 241c90c

Revision 241c90c by Clément Foucault (master)
February 25, 2018, 16:58 (GMT)
DRW/GWN: Bypass glUseProgram.

Turns out to be the call that was destroying performance.

I get 18ms->6ms improvement of drawing time with 10 000 unique objects.

And we can still improve upon this!

Commit Details:

Full Hash: 241c90c92d8dfc4f98daad71fb75390793777a86
Parent Commit: 24d51a0
Lines Changed: +91, -85

3 Modified Paths:

/intern/gawain/gawain/gwn_batch.h (+1, -1) (Diff)
/intern/gawain/src/gwn_batch.c (+86, -80) (Diff)
/source/blender/draw/intern/draw_manager.c (+4, -4) (Diff)
Tehnyt: Miika HämäläinenViimeksi päivitetty: 07.11.2014 14:18MiikaH:n Sivut a.k.a. MiikaHweb | 2003-2021